Hard Rock Quarry (U) Limited v Commissioner Land Registration & Another
Hard Rock Quarry (U) Limited v Commissioner Land Registration & Another (Civil Appeal No. 115 of 2015) [2019] UGHC 25 (11 December 2019)
The court held that an affidavit commissioned by an advocate who has been barred from practice is incompetent and cannot be relied upon as evidence. The commission to act as a commissioner for oaths is tied to the advocate's valid practising certificate, and once the advocate is disbarred, any affidavits commissioned thereafter are invalid. The court struck out the affidavit in reply by Abid Alam, as it was commissioned by Augustine Ssemakula after he had been barred.
